Choosing the Perfect Surface for Your Driveway
When designing a new driveway, choosing the suitable tarmacadam mix is critical. Different thicknesses, gravel types, and binder grades are available, each providing unique levels of strength and visual look. A shallower layer might be adequate for a pedestrian area, while a robust mix with a increased aggregate content is needed for a busy driveway subjected to significant car volume. Advising with a reputable tarmacadam contractor is advised to guarantee you obtain the best product for your specific needs and price range.
Asphalt Driveway Construction: A Gradual Manual
Beginning your fresh tarmacadam area project requires careful preparation. First, the current surface needs taking up, ensuring a level foundation . This usually involves removing topsoil and solidifying the ground. Next, a coat of hardcore, typically gravel , is spread and similarly compacted. A leveling layer of tarmacadam is then applied, followed by the top coat of tarmacadam, which must be flattened to achieve a smooth appearance . Sufficient drainage is vital and should be considered during the design phase.
Caring For Your Tarmacadam Driveway For Years To Come
A pristine tarmacadam surface can significantly boost your property’s curb appeal, but it needs consistent attention to keep it in top condition. Periodically sweeping away dirt and pebbles is vital to prevent wear and tear. Addressing tiny splits promptly with a repair compound will halt them from worsening into significant problems. Avoid placing substantial weight on the surface whenever possible, and consider rinsing your driveway every few months a year to lift dirt. Following these easy suggestions will help protect your driveway and ensure looking its finest for decades to come.

Tarmacadam Driveways vs. Alternatives: Which is Best for You?
Choosing the right surface for your driveway can be a complex decision. Bitmac, a popular choice , offers a smooth finish and relatively inexpensive installation costs. However, it’s not the only solution . Think about alternatives like permeable paving, gravel, block paving, or concrete. Permeable paving is fantastic for drainage and green living, while gravel provides a traditional look. Block paving adds character and allows for easy repairs, although it’s typically considerably expensive. Concrete is robust but can crack over time. To make the best choice for your property, weigh your budget, appearance preferences, drainage needs, and desired level of maintenance.
- Tarmacadam: Delivers a classic look and is relatively affordable.
- Permeable Paving: Suitable for boosting drainage and lessening runoff.
- Gravel: A cost-effective option with a organic feel.
- Block Paving: Provides a beautiful look and enables for repairs.
- Concrete: A sturdy surface, but likely to cracking.
